RSPU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2026 in Review
132 of the 8,305 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Invesco S&P 500 Equal Weight Utilities ETF (RSPU) for Q2 2026, worth a combined $254M — down 3.6% from $263M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 22 funds opened new RSPU positions and 14 closed out — a net gain of 8 holders — while 50 added to existing stakes and 36 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$3.22M. The largest seller was Victory Financial Group, exiting entirely with an estimated $4.85M sold.
